Which of the following best describes why researchers think people engage in aggressive driving? a. People have learned that it'

s an acceptable response to physical sensations associated with stress. b. It is due primarily to the way that people's parents drove. c. People think their driving skills improve as they age, leading to increased levels of narcissism. d. It can be attributed mostly to genetic factors that produce an overall increase in aggression.

Answer:

The Correct Answer is A

People have learned that it's an acceptable response to physical sensations associated with stress.

Explanation:

Aggressive driving is described as any behind-the-wheel function that puts another person or property at risk through intentional activity without consideration to safety.

Aggressive driving can vary from risky response to that which heightens to dangerous violence.

Here are some examples of Aggressive driving such as

  • Changing lanes without giving signals.
  • Weaving In and Out from the traffic
  • Cutting in front of another vehicle and then slow it down and try to provoke another driver.
  • Speeding in heavy traffic
  • Blocking the way of other cars and passing or changing lanes.
  • Rash driving and breaking traffic rules.

Answer: availability heuristic

Explanation:

Availability heuristic is very useful and essential in decision making or taking. Most times in our decision making process, we tend to recur information or things that occurs a long time ago or a common phenomenon that suddenly appears in our thoughts and we base our decision at times by the outcome of those thoughts. Example is when phone theft I reported on TV constantly, you can infer mostly that it occurs in you area often that it does. In this type, you give power to the information and most times you overestimate the likelihood of it occuring.
